

Alchemist's Kitchen by Guy Ogilvy
What is the secret meaning of alchemical symbolism? Could ancient images really turn molten lead into gold with a mere pinch of the Philosopher's Stone? Alchemy is perhaps the last magical art to survive the ravages of the modern world. This book initiates the reader into some of the key concepts and practices of this extraordinary field of study.-
